To excel as an ASP.NET Web API developer, you need strong skills in C#, .NET Framework, RESTful API design, and a relevant degree in computer science or related fields. Experience with Visual Studio, SQL databases, version control systems (such as Git), and certifications like Microsoft Certified: Azure Developer Associate are highly valued. Effective communication, problem-solving abilities, and a collaborative mindset help set top candidates apart. These technical and interpersonal skills are crucial for building, maintaining, and scaling APIs that meet organizational and client needs efficiently.